SC Refuses to Lift Ban on Mining in Uttarakhand District

The Supreme Court on Thursday refused to interfere with a judicial order suspending all mining activities in Uttarakhand's Bageshwar district, citing alarming findings of environmental degradation and safety risks detailed in a report submitted by court commissioners.

- Utkarsh Anand

NEW DELHI:

A bench comprising Chief Justice of India (CJI) Sanjiv Khanna and justices Sanjay Kumar and KV Viswanathan made it clear that it would not disturb the Uttarakhand high court's directions, calling the report "damning" and urging mining operators to approach the high court instead.

"This is serious. We are not going to interfere with this order," remarked the bench while declining relief to the mining companies challenging the high court's decision earlier this month.

Senior advocate Dhruv Mehta, representing Katiyar Mining and Industrial Corporation, argued that the report was prepared by lawyers and not experts. However, the bench dismissed the contention, stating: "They may not be experts, but they have done a fairly good job."

Another senior advocate, Shyam Divan, appearing for a different mining company, pointed out that a similar matter was pending before the National Green Tribunal (NGT), which had set up its own committee to investigate. The court, however, reiterated that the petitioners should return to the high court, noting that the order was only interim in nature.
